The Generational Leap: Gen11 to Gen12 Evolution

As computational demands rise, legacy server platforms are struggling to manage modern throughput requirements. Transitioning from HPE Gen11 to Gen12 architectures introduces significant upgrades in architectural efficiency:

  • Memory Throughput: Gen12 introduces DDR5 memory systems operating at speeds up to 6400 MT/s, delivering a massive 50%+ boost in memory bandwidth over Gen11. This is critical for memory-bound virtualization applications and real-time database transactions.
  • PCIe Gen5 Capability: Doubling the bandwidth of PCIe Gen4, the integration of PCIe Gen5 lanes in Gen12 structures facilitates ultra-fast interconnects for NVMe flash drives and high-performance network interface cards (NICs) without hitting CPU bottlenecks.
  • Compute Core Density: Supporting Intel® Xeon 6 and Intel Scalable processors, these units allow up to 144 cores per socket. This density helps consolidate older, multi-system server racks into a streamlined footprint, reducing physical facility space and operational overhead.
  • Integrated Security Foundations: With the development of the HPE iLO 6 ASIC, systems run on an unalterable Silicon Root of Trust, establishing a secure hardware perimeter. This feature aligns directly with Australian government guidelines on data integrity.

Energy-Efficiency & Liquid Cooling in Warm Australian Environments

With summer temperatures in regional mining locations regularly topping 45°C, managing thermal loads is a primary concern for local operations. Implementing liquid-cooled server configurations, such as the direct liquid cooling (DLC) loops available in HPE Gen12 systems, enables data centers to run at higher compute loads without relying on expensive, traditional mechanical chillers. This significantly improves Power Usage Effectiveness (PUE) metrics and supports corporate sustainability targets.

Meeting National Regulatory & Import Controls

Exporting high-performance enterprise equipment to Australia requires strict compliance with local regulatory frameworks. Veltrixa ensures all configured components and systems meet key import requirements:

  • RCM Compliance: All server power supplies (PSUs) and associated electronics feature the Regulatory Compliance Mark (RCM), verifying compliance with Australian electrical safety and elect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) guidelines.
  • Biosecurity Measures: We coordinate with our logistics partners to ensure all packing materials, particularly wooden crates for heavy rack-level systems, meet the import requirements of the Department of Agriculture, Fisheries and Forestry (DAFF).
  • Comprehensive Freight Tracking: Every shipment is backed by end-to-end documentation, transparent HS code categorization, and carrier updates. We ship directly to key cargo centers, including the Port of Melbourne, Sydney Airport (SYD), Port of Brisbane, and Fremantle.
